Anatomy and physiology of the suprachoroid -- Imaging the suprachoroidal space -- Suprachoroidal haemorrhage and its management -- Choroidal effusions and ocular hypotony management -- Suprachoroidal space and glaucoma -- Suprachoroidalbuckling for peripheral retinal breaks -- Suprachoroidal buckling for myopic macular holes -- Suprachoroidal drug delivery -- Suprachoroidal approach in the delivery of subretinal gene therapy -- Suprachoroidal retinal implant.
This book provides a practical overview of pathology and interventions in the suprachoroidal space of the eye. Concise and well-structured chapters examine anatomy, physiology and pathophysiology, suprachoroidal haemorrhage, choroidal effusions and ocular hypotony management, imaging, suprachoroidal buckling for retinal detachment, drug delivery, suprachoroidal glaucoma devices, subretinal gene therapy and suprachoroidal retinal implant. Suprachoroidal Space Interventions meets the need for a book that improves awareness of established and novel interventions in the suprachoroidal space, particularly as it has been increasingly recognised as a potential space for glaucoma surgery, drug deliveries and retinal surgery. Ophthalmologists and scientists with an interest in glaucoma and retinal surgery will find the book to be an easy to use reference tool for a rapidly developing area of ophthalmology that can be applied in modern clinical practice. .
